Agrifood systems — Emissions Share (CO2eq) (AR5) in Slovenia
Slovenia: Agrifood systems — Emissions Share (CO2eq) (AR5) was 34.63 % in 2023. ◆ Volatile
Agrifood systems — Emissions Share (CO2eq) (AR5) in Slovenia, 1992–2023
Source: Food and Agriculture Organization of the United Nations. Measured in %.
Analysis
Slovenia recorded 34.63 % for agrifood systems — emissions share (co2eq) (ar5) in 2023.
The figure is up 4.2% on the previous year and down 4.0% over ten years.
Over the whole period, agrifood systems — emissions share (co2eq) (ar5) in Slovenia peaked at 40.54 % in 2015 and was at its lowest, 0.81 %, in 1998.
That places Slovenia 95th out of 147 countries with data for 2023, putting it in the middle of the range.
The series is highly variable year to year, so single readings are best treated with caution.

About this data
The FAOSTAT domain on Emissions indicators disseminates indicators on sectoral shares of total national greenhouse gas (GHG) emissions as well as three indicators of emissions intensity: per capita emissions; emissions per value of agricultural production; and emissions per area of agricultural land.
